摘 要:文章系统分析了皮革企业生产加工过程中废水的来源、成分及其环境污染特征,并探讨了相应的治理对策。研究表明,皮革企业废水具有水量大、污染负荷高、成分复杂等特点,主要来源于鞣前、鞣制和鞣后三个阶段,其中鞣前阶段废水污染负荷占比高达60%。针对含硫废水等复杂污染物,可采用化学沉淀法、混凝沉淀法等技术进行治理,同时结合“水解+好氧生化(CAST)+生物脱氮技术”等绿色工艺,从源头减少废水排放。此外,通过推动产业转型升级、优化生产流程、引入清洁生产理念及循环经济模式,可有效提升废水治理效率,降低环境污染。文章为皮革企业废水治理提供了理论依据和实践指导,对实现行业可持续发展具有重要意义。This paper systematically analyzes the sources,composition,and environmental pollution characteristics of wastewater generated during the production and processing of leather enterprises,and explores corresponding treatment strategies.The research shows that leather enterprise wastewater is characterized by large volume,high pollution load,and complex composition,primarily originating from the pre-tanning,tanning,and post-tanning stages,with the pre-tanning stage contributing up to 60%of the pollution load.For complex pollutants such as sulfur-containing wastewater,technologies such as chemical precipitation and coagulation precipitation can be employed,combined with green processes like"hydrolysis+aerobic biochemical(CAST)+biological denitrification"to reduce wastewater discharge at the source.Additionally,by promoting industrial transformation and upgrading,optimizing production processes,and adopting clean production concepts and circular economy models,the efficiency of wastewater treatment can be significantly improved,reducing environmental pollution.This paper provides theoretical and practical guidance for wastewater treatment in leather enterprises,contributing to the sustainable development of the industry.
